What drivers are you using? I know from experience the 355.82 nVidia drivers do exactly what you are describing on multiple games. The 355.90 work better, Im not sure if they are better than the 355.60 ones so try both.

With the 8016 error I mentioned above I stand corrected, I set up a dual boot to my old Windows 8.1 drive (OEM so thought this wouldnt work but it did) and ran the game, had the same problem. At this point I shift my focus from Win10 to Skylake.
So I went and checked my BIOS version and there was an update, nothing specific to this issue but I figured Id try it.
This did resolve the issue and I have been able to load into Sims3 fully patched (without EP's Ill try them later) where I couldnt before. So where Gigabyte specifically identified their update fixed this issue Asus did not.
For Asus users you need to go to http://support.asus.com/download/options.aspx?SLanguage=en and put the model of motherboard ie Maximus VIII ranger, select the OS and then expand BIOS. Mine for the above mention board were at 0401 an update to 0801 is there, download it and save it to a USB drive. You then reboot, go into BIOS and use the EZ updater to update the BIOS using the file you just downloaded to USB. When it starts WAIT, do not do anything until you boot into Windows, it may look like your PC is done but it switches off and on a few times when its done it booted up to windows for me (had to restart and re-apply certain BIOS settings).
Gigabyte have a similar update available http://www.gigabyte.com/support-downloads/download-center.aspx and choose your motherboard etc like the above example. I dont know how their BIOS update works but Im sure theres instruction on their site.
